House Prices (2025)

Most affordable in Wales

Buyers will find Aberdare more wallet-friendly, where the average price is £172,897 versus £292,309 in Bedwas. The most affordable entry point in Aberdare is a flat at £69,500, while in Bedwas it is a flat at £89,000.

Average Price by Property Type (2025)

Biggest gap: terraced homes are 52% pricier in Bedwas (£250,444 vs £120,617).

Price Trend (11 Years)

Over the last 9 years, Bedwas prices grew faster — 65% vs 50%.

Broadband & Connectivity

Internet users in Bedwas enjoy 446.7 Mbps on average, while Aberdare lags behind at 355.7 Mbps. Superfast coverage (30 Mbps+) reaches 96% of premises in Aberdare and 97.8% in Bedwas. Gigabit availability stands at 65.7% in Aberdare and 85.9% in Bedwas.

Bedwas is the faster of the two by 26% on average download speed (447 vs 356 Mbps).

Energy Efficiency & Running Costs

The average EPC rating in Bedwas is band C (score 71.5), ahead of Aberdare's band C (score 70). Estimated annual energy costs average £1,352 in Aberdare and £1,117 in Bedwas. 61.6% of homes in Aberdare have an EPC rating of C or above, compared to 64.2% in Bedwas.

Bedwas has more energy-efficient housing — 64.2% reach band C or above, vs 61.6% in the other.

Demographics & Economy

Aberdare has a population of 37,675 while Bedwas has 6,463. Median household income is £29,441.3 in Bedwas and £29,380 in Aberdare. The median age is 46.2 in Aberdare and 41.3 in Bedwas. Employment rates stand at 54.3% in Aberdare and 54% in Bedwas.
